How To Choose The Best Mixer And Grinder
Your ideal machine isn’t just about power; it’s about matching its capabilities to the textures and quantities you create most often. Let’s break down the decision points.
Motor Power and Type
Wattage indicates potential, but motor construction dictates endurance. For frequent heavy grinding like idli batter or nuts, look for motors in the 550W to 750W range with full copper windings, which handle heat better and offer more torque. For occasional smoothies or dips, 400W to 700W is sufficient.
Jar Configuration and Material
Stainless steel jars resist staining and are generally more durable, while high-grade polycarbonate is lighter and often BPA-free. Multiple jars (a small chutney jar, a medium wet-grinding jar, a large blending jar) offer versatility. Check that lids seal tightly and are easy to lock and unlock.
Speed Settings and Control
Variable speed knobs provide fine-tuned control for pastes and batters, while pulse functions are excellent for achieving coarse chops or breaking up ice. Some premium models include preset programs for specific tasks, simplifying the process.
Noise and Stability
A powerful motor will generate sound, but well-built models with balanced blades and solid suction feet minimize vibration and noise. If you have an open kitchen or cook early in the morning, this is a critical factor.
Ease of Cleaning and Safety
Dishwasher-safe jars and blades save time. Look for safety locks that prevent the motor from starting unless the jar is securely attached, and overload protection that safeguards the motor during extended use.

Understanding the Specs
Motor Wattage & Type
Wattage (e.g., 550W, 1000W) indicates raw power, but motor construction is key. “Full Copper” or “Heavy Duty” motors offer better heat dissipation and torque for sustained grinding, especially for tough tasks like batter or nut butters. Lower wattage motors (400W-550W) suffice for occasional blending and grinding.
Jar Material & Capacity
Stainless Steel jars are durable, stain-resistant, and handle heat better. Polycarbonate jars are lighter, often BPA-free, and can be transparent. Capacity should match your typical batch size—small jars (0.3L-0.5L) for chutneys, medium (1L) for pastes, and large (1.5L+) for batters and family-sized blends.
